best font for 800x600 resolution??
Hi there,
Was just wondering does anyone know a good font to use when designing for 800x6oo resolution??ive tried alot of the ones on my computer and they're all coming out a bit blurred.is there any way around this or will it be like this for all fonts because of the low resolution?? Any suggestions would be appreciated. Laurie ![]() |

A 14pt or higher sans-serif font like Arial will probably look the cleanest. But there is nothing you can really do about the blur. Every user has a different computer with different settings.
As long as your page is readable you're covered in that regaurd.
